John C. Williams, a renowned guitarist, invites you to experience the soothing and evocative sounds of "Pure Acoustic," released on May 1, 2008, under the West One Music label. This classical album, spanning 54 minutes, is a testament to Williams' mastery of the acoustic guitar, featuring 24 tracks that seamlessly blend melody and harmony.
"Pure Acoustic" is a journey through various moods and landscapes, from the serene "Placidity" and "Countryside Garden" to the reflective "Reminiscence" and "Forgotten Man." Each track is a standalone piece, yet they collectively form a cohesive whole, showcasing Williams' versatility and depth as a musician. The album opens with "Journey of Life," setting the tone for the introspective and melodic exploration that follows.
Highlights include the tender "Touch so Tender," the hopeful "Under the Rainbow," and the poignant "Gone Forever." The album concludes with "Final Train," leaving a lasting impression of Williams' artistic prowess.
